      The story revolves around two neighbors, Tottie and Dot, whose peaceful lives take a turn as they engage in a fierce competition to create the best house. As their rivalry escalates, they must confront the potential loss of their friendship. This beautifully illustrated book not only entertains young readers but also imparts a meaningful lesson about the value of friendship over competition.

      Now in paperback, meet Charlie, Ruby, Oliver, Mason and Kaia — Kiwi kids representing a multicultural blend of culture and race that typifies our amazing country. They’ll take you through a year in the life of New Zealand's kids, from celebrations, traditions and events, to our everyday way of life and the little things that make childhood so memorable.A Kiwi Year is a picture book bursting with national pride. It’s a snapshot of who we are as New Zealanders, blending our modern-day culture and lifestyle with past traditions and native heritage. Its pages feature meandering text, dates and gorgeous illustrations showcasing our five Kiwi kids at play, at school, at home, and enjoying the sights and sites of our great nation. From the Bay of Islands to our hot springs and soaring mountains, vibrant cities and quaint country towns, this is our New Zealand childhood.

      Set against the backdrop of urban Beijing, the narrative follows a tai tai who navigates the complexities of suburban family life with candor and humor. Through her intensely personal experiences, she explores the challenges and joys of motherhood and marriage, revealing the cultural nuances and societal expectations of expat life. The book offers a candid look at the struggles and triumphs of maintaining identity while adapting to a foreign environment, making it both relatable and thought-provoking.
